1. Early Detection, Hidden Dangers
Advanced imaging now enables earlier than ever detection of diseases — sometimes years before symptoms appear. For example, low-dose CT scanners catch lung nodules at precancerous stages, but this also introduces the possibility of overdiagnosis and anxiety over “potential” tumors. Is every detected anomaly a future threat — or simply a false warning? The answer matters a lot.
2. The Power of AI in Image Analysis
Artificial intelligence is transforming imaging by detecting subtle patterns human eyes might miss. Machine learning models analyze millions of scans to spot early signs of Alzheimer’s, stroke, or heart disease — sometimes years ahead. But with this power comes uncertainty: AI predictions rely on data, which can be biased, incomplete, or open to interpretation. So while the truth might be inside the image, the certainty isn’t always clear.

What Should You Do?
If imaging reveals “there’s a chance” — even if it’s science-backed — don’t panic. Instead:
- Ask your doctor for a clear interpretation, especially if results are unexpected.
- Understand the limits of imaging: it shows probabilities, not certainties.
- Evaluate risks through a holistic lens — personal history, lifestyle, and psychological readiness.
- Stay informed but avoid fear-driven reactions—imaging reveals, but doesn’t dictate fate.
